Orchids account for a great part of the worldwide floriculture trade both as cut flowers and as potted plants and are assessed to comprise around 10% of global fresh cut flower trade. A better understanding of the basic botanical characteristics, flower regulation, molecular cytogenetics, karyotypes and DNA content of important orchids will aid in the efficient development of new cultivars. The book also describes the composition, expression and function of various microRNAs and simple sequence repeats.
